4+ years of experience in the Software Quality Assurance area including multiple roles such as Software Test Engineer, QA Engineer and QA Consultant. Experience in planning, developing and deploying test strategies for large - scale Web Applications and client/server and multi-tier based business applications. Experience in Performance testing using JMeter (Load/stress) Experience in developing Functional Test. Experience in Testing responsive web, Hybrid and native applications. Proficient in writing Test Plans and Test Cases. Experience in Bug tracking tool such as Jira/Clickup/Trello Experience in Test driven development for functional and integration. Extensive experience in Black Box, White Box, Unit, Functional, Integration Testing, Regression, Volume, User Acceptance (UAT), Smoke and Security. Extensive experience in SDLC and QA methodologies such as Agile and Waterfall Processes. Excellent experience in API Testing using postman and JMeter Experience in backend testing with strong SQL skills. Reviewed test plans and test strategies and involved in test summary report Preparation Involved in software certification process, project reviews and project status meetings. Good organizational and communication skills, with the ability to express technical concepts verbally and in written. Quick learner and has the ability to adapt in a fast-paced environment.
Overview
4
4
years of professional experience
Work History
QA/software Engineer
Treeline Interactive, Inc
06.2023 - Current
Responsible for functional and regression testing through manual testing processes.
Created daily QA status reports, and actively participated in SQA and project status meetings.
Written and executed API scripts for backend applications using Rest Assured API testing.
Coordinate defect review meetings with the Development Team and other project stakeholders.
Worked closely with business analysts, developers, and database architects to identify outstanding issues in user requirements and specifications.
Created and executed test Scripts using QC for System, Integration and Regression testing
Participated in daily agile scrum meetings
Prepared status summary reports with details of executed test cases.
Roles & Responsibility
Five Iron Golf -
Test Planning: Define the scope, approach, resources, and schedule for testing activities.
Test Case Development: Create detailed test cases based on game requirements and specifications.
Test Execution: Run tests to identify bugs or issues in the game software.
Bug Reporting: Document and report defects found during testing to the development team.
Regression Testing: Verify that new code changes do not adversely affect existing functionalities.
Performance Testing: Assess the game's performance under various conditions, including load and stress testing.
User Experience Testing: Evaluate the game's usability and overall player experience.
Collaboration: Work closely with developers, designers, and product managers to ensure quality and timely delivery.
Primeops.primeappearance.com(Prime flight)-
Test Planning: Outline the testing strategy, objectives, resources, and timelines for the maintenance software.
Requirements Analysis: Review and understand functional and non-functional requirements specific to flight maintenance software.
Test Case Development: Create detailed test cases based on the requirements to cover various scenarios, including maintenance scheduling, tracking, and reporting.
Test Execution: Perform the actual testing of the software, which may include manual, automated, and integration testing.
Defect Identification and Reporting: Identify and document any issues or defects found during testing, providing sufficient detail for developers to replicate and fix them.
Regression Testing: Ensure that recent updates or bug fixes do not negatively impact existing functionalities of the maintenance software.
Performance Testing: Test the software under various load conditions to ensure it meets performance standards and can handle the required volumes of data.
User Acceptance Testing (UAT): Facilitate UAT with stakeholders or end-users to ensure the software meets their needs and expectations.
Documentation: Maintain comprehensive documentation of test processes, test cases, and results for future reference and compliance purposes.
Collaboration with Cross-Functional Teams: Work closely with developers, project managers, and maintenance engineers to ensure a comprehensive understanding of the software and its operational context.
XGames-
Test Strategy Development: Leading the design and implementation of test strategies aligned with project goals.
Mentoring Junior Testers: Guiding and mentoring less experienced team members in testing best practices and methodologies.
Automation Framework Development: Designing, implementing, and maintaining automation frameworks to increase testing efficiency.
Test Management: Overseeing the test life cycle, including test planning, execution, and reporting on testing progress and results.
Risk Analysis: Identifying, analyzing, and mitigating risks associated with software releases.
Collaboration with Stakeholders: Coordinating with developers, product managers, and other stakeholders to clarify requirements and enhance test coverage.
Performance and Security Testing: Leading efforts in performance testing and security testing to ensure the software meets quality expectations.
Continuous Improvement: Advocating for and implementing improvements in testing processes and tools to enhance efficiency and effectiveness.
Defect Triage: Participating in defect triage meetings and prioritizing defect fixes based on project timelines and impact.
Reporting and Documentation: Providing detailed test reports to stakeholders and maintaining documentation for compliance and future reference.
Transpoworks-
Test Planning and Strategy: Developing comprehensive test plans and strategies that align with business objectives and project requirements.
Team Leadership: Leading testing initiatives and mentoring junior team members to enhance their skills and knowledge in testing methodologies.
Risk Assessment: Identifying potential risks in the software development lifecycle and creating test strategies to mitigate them.
Cross-functional collaboration: Working closely with developers, business analysts, and project managers to ensure clear understanding of requirements and expected outcomes.
Test Execution and Reporting: Executing manual and automated tests, preparing comprehensive test reports, and communicating results to stakeholders.
Defect Management: Leading defect triage meetings, logging and tracking defects, and working with development teams for timely resolution.
Performance and Load Testing: Conducting performance and load testing to ensure the application meets scalability and performance expectations.
Continuous Improvement: Proactively suggesting and implementing process improvements to enhance the overall quality assurance process.
Documentation: Maintaining up-to-date documentation of test cases, test results, and testing processes for future reference and compliance.
IT Analyst
Zyoin
02.2023 - 06.2023
Create and maintain traceability matrix for testing coverage in each iteration
Verifying data on DB with SQL
Data migration and data verification with API and validating those data in DB
Mapping the date on Micro service with manually running Curls on Cabernet's Architecture
Attended daily agile scrum meetings and completed deliverables on or before time in a two-week agile sprint project
Coordinate Defect review meetings with Development Team, Business Analysts
Responsible for Functional and Regression testing
Project included an end-to-end system testing for data flow across the different components and services
Involved in writing test scripts based on User Stories, Product backlog and design specifications
Responsible for Creating, executing and reviewing Test cases and Report & Monitor defects in JIRA agile tracking tools
Sr QA Engineer
Webkorps Optimal Solutions
07.2020 - 11.2022
Responsible for Functional and Regression testing through manual testing processes
Involved in writing test scripts based on User Stories, Product backlog and design specifications.
Roles & Responsibility:-
Asset Panda
The project included end-to-end system testing for data flow across the different components and services.
Responsible for Creating, executing and reviewing Test cases and Report & Monitor defects in JIRA agile tracking tools.
integrate with Business Analyst and Developers in testing and documentation for Applications developed in SIT environment.
Created daily QA status reports, andactively participated in SQA and project status meetings.
Coordinate Defect review meetings with the development Team, Business Analysts, and other project stakeholders.
Execute Functional, System integration, and Regression testing.
Participated in thepreparation of the overall project plan.
Scoutr
Create and maintain traceability matrix for testing coverage in each iteration.
Attended daily agile scrum meetings and completed deliverables on or before time in a two-week agile sprint project.
Coordinate Defect review meetings with Development Team, Business Analysts and
Responsible for Functional and Regression testing
Project included an end-to-end system testing for data flow across the different components and services.
Involved in writing test scripts based on User Stories, Product backlog and design specifications.
Execute Functional, System integration and Regression testing.
Participated in preparation of the overall project plan. ▪ project status meetings.